Section 8 Housing
Section 8 housing, also known as the Housing Choice Voucher program, offers rental assistance to low-income residents. Receive a voucher as high as $2,000 per month to rent or buy property. Call toll-free for more information 800-225-5342.

The Operation HOPE Home Buyers Program
Operation HOPE has a program to help low-income home buyers. The main benefits are FDIC-approved loans, down payment assistance and first-time buying assistance. Apply by contacting the HOPE office in your city. For questions, call the center at (888) 388-4673.

Shelter Plus Care Program
Shelter Plus Care (S+C) provides rental assistance to disabled and homeless populations. There are four types of programs: tenant-based, sponsor-based, project-based and Section 8 moderate rehabilitation for single room occupancy (SRO). Contact the nearest HUD field office to apply or call 1-202-708-1112.

Habitat for Humanity Housing Solution
Habitat for Humanity has a program to help you build or repair affordable homes. To participate in the program, pay a small down payment and contribute sweat equity to build your home. Contact a nearby Habitat office if you are interested. Call 1-800-422-4828 for help.

HUD Homes for Sale
The U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D) has a directory of economical homes for sale. Search for your property based on state, city and type of HUD Special Program.
